Why prices for improving toolbelts and saddles are different?
Because saddle takes 0,25 leather for every improve. So improving to 90 takes about 25kg of leather! Toolbelts are the hardest to improve... it takes very long to improve one, no matter what quality! So improving to 90 takes me 2-3 times longer than any armour part.
